Output c78ca61b538bb4a505786a7839cb17f35d05d972bd3a0f840a0b6d38c7a73c59:1

value
351293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1e967b40c45c1415631e79a8d72cd68ea21cf4 OP_EQUAL
address
3MfcYqJ649HTA9qMsGm7Pkxp4cf8LqP6A2
transaction
c78ca61b538bb4a505786a7839cb17f35d05d972bd3a0f840a0b6d38c7a73c59
confirmations
273572
spent
true